English Translation

Anas ibn Malik (رضي الله عنه) said: "I have never seen the Messenger of Allah ﷺ grieve over anything as much as he grieved over the companions of Bi'r Ma'unah. They were called 'the reciters,' and they were seventy men. the Messenger of Allah ﷺ supplicated against their killers in the qunut of the dawn prayer for thirty mornings, supplicating against Ri'l, Dhakwan, and Lihyan."

Reference: Musnad Ahmad, Book 26, Hadith 318
